Course Description

3739. Physical Chemistry 1. Principles and applications of thermodynamics and kinetics to chemical systems. Prereq.: "C" or better in CHEM 3720, PHYS 2610, MATH 1572. 3 s.h.

Schedule of Topics and Assignments

Day Date Reading(s) Proposed Topic Due/To Prepare for Class
Mon 8/24 Focus (Chapters) 1 Introduction, Temperature
Wed 8/26 Focus 1 Pressure, Gas Laws, Real Gases
Mon 8/31 Focus 1 Equations of State
Wed 9/2 Focus 2 1st Law, Work, Heat, Enthalpy, Cv, Quiz 1
Mon 9/7 No Class
Wed 9/9 Focus 2 Cp, Adiabatic Changes, Thermochemistry
Mon 9/14 Focus 3 2nd Law, Entropy, Phase Transition
Wed 9/16 Focus 3 Boltzmann, Carnot, 3rd Law, Maxwell Relations Quiz 2
Mon 9/21 Focus 4 Components, Phase Diagrams
Wed 9/23 Exam 1: Focus (Chapters) 1, 2, 3
Mon 9/28 Focus 4 Chemical Potential
Wed 9/30 Focus 5 Mixtures, Partial Molar Volume
Mon 10/5 Focus 5 Pressure, Colligative Properties
Wed 10/7 Focus 5 Lever Rule, Binary Systems, Miscible Liquids Quiz 3
Mon 10/12 Focus 5 Activities, Chemical Equilibrium
Wed 10/14 Focus 6 Electrochemistry Quiz 4
Mon 10/19 Focus 6 Half Reactions, Nernst Equation
Wed 10/21 Exam 2: Focus (Chapters) 4, 5, 6
Mon 10/26 Focus 16 Kinetic Model of Gases, Mean Free Path
Wed 10/28 Focus 16 Diffusion, Viscosity
Mon 11/2 Focus 17 Kinetics, Rate Law
Wed 11/4 Focus 17 Reaction Order, Integrated Rate Law
Mon 11/9 Focus 17 Consecutive/Parallel Reactions Quiz 5
Wed 11/11 No Class
Mon 11/16 Focus 17 Steady-State Approx.
Wed 11/18 Exam 3: Focus (Chapters) 6, 16, 17
Mon 11/23 Focus 18 Reaction Theory, Transition State Theory
Wed 11/25 No Class
Mon 11/30 Focus 18 Activated Complex, Pot. Energy Surfaces Quiz 6
Wed 12/2 Quantum, Particle in a Box
Mon 12/7 Final Exam: 1:00 p.m. - 3:00 p.m.
